码迷,mamicode.com
首页 >  
搜索关键字:顺序存储    ( 1306个结果
数据结构之栈——顺序存储结构(php代码实现)
<?php /** 1.DestroyStack():栈的销毁 2.ClearStack():将栈置为空栈 3.StackEmpty():判断栈是否为空 4.StackLength():返回栈的长度 5.GetTop():取得栈顶的元素 6.Push():插入新的栈顶元素 7.Pop():删除栈顶元素 8.StackTraverse():遍历栈元素 */ //除了push和pop方法外,其..
分类:Web程序   时间:2015-01-06 15:50:40    阅读次数:117
数据结构之线性表:顺序存储
SeqList.h 1 #define ListSize 100 2 3 typedef int DataType; 4 typedef struct { 5 DataType list[ListSize]; 6 int length; 7 }SeqList; 8 9 void ...
分类:其他好文   时间:2015-01-04 14:55:28    阅读次数:269
数据结构之线性表——顺序存储结构(php代码实现)
<?php /** * *线性表:即零个或多个数据元素的有限序列。 *线性表的数据结构:即数据元素依此存储在一段地址连续的存储单元内。在高级语言中就表现为数组。 * *1.DestroyList:销毁顺序线性表 *2.ClearList:将线性表重置为空 *3.ListEmpty:判断线性表是否为空 *4.ListLength:..
分类:Web程序   时间:2015-01-01 18:37:43    阅读次数:181
数组排序
//1.使用sortedArrayUsingSelector //也是最简单的排序方式 //数组是按照你存入元素的顺序存储的 NSArray * array = @[@"b",@"d",@"a",@"z"]; N...
分类:编程语言   时间:2014-12-30 21:54:13    阅读次数:266
数据结构与算法学习 第1季01 顺序表 链表
2015年学习计划安排:http://www.cnblogs.com/cyrus-ho/p/4182275.html顺序表:顺序存储结构的线性表。所谓顺序存储结构,就是指用一组连续地址的内存单元来存储整张线性表的存储结构。(因此按序遍历数据很方便,直接做指针偏移就可以了。)常用操作A)向顺序表中第i...
分类:编程语言   时间:2014-12-30 18:31:43    阅读次数:178
02.线性表(一)顺序存储结构
顺序存储结构 一、线性表基本概念 1.线性表定义     线性表(list)是指零个或多个数据元素的有限序列,所有数据元素为相同数据类型且一个数据元素可以由多个数据项组成。若将线性表记为(a1,..ai-1,ai,ai+1...,an),线性表元素的个数n(n>0,n=0时为空表)定义为线性表的长度,其中ai-1是ai 的直接前驱元素,ai+1是ai的直接后继元素。 2.线性表的抽象数据类...
分类:其他好文   时间:2014-12-28 20:53:40    阅读次数:157
04.线性表(三)链式存储结构.单链表2
链式存储结构.单链表2     顺序存储结构的创建实质是一个数组的初始化,存储空间连续且其大小和类型已经固定;单链表存储空间不连续,是一种动态结构且它所占用空间的大小和位置是不需要预先分配划定的,可以根据系统的情况和实际的需求即时生成。 一.单链表的整表创建     创建单链表的过程就是一个动态生成链表的过程,即从“空表”的初始化起,依次建立各元素结点,并逐个插入链表。 1.算法思路 ...
分类:其他好文   时间:2014-12-28 20:51:41    阅读次数:211
[翻译] C++ STL容器参考手册(第一章 <array>)
返回总册1. std::array (C++11支持)template class array;数组类数组容器是固定长度的序列容器:按照严格的线性顺序,存储一定数量的元素。数组容器内部并不维护除了元素本身之外的任何数据(甚至不保存自己的size,这是一个编译时就确定的模板参数)。数组容器对存储空间....
分类:编程语言   时间:2014-12-28 11:38:37    阅读次数:270
并行归并排序——MPI
并行归并排序在程序开始时,会将n/comm_comm个键值分配给每个进程,程序结束时,所有的键值会按顺序存储在进程0中。为了做到这点,它使用了树形结构通信模式。当进程接收到另一个进程的键值时,它将该键值合并进自己排序的键值列表中。编写一个程序实现归并排序。进程0应该读入n的值,将其广播给其余进程。....
分类:编程语言   时间:2014-12-24 21:21:34    阅读次数:1058
数据结构与算法概念解析
数据之间的相互关系称为逻辑结构。通常分为四类基本结构:  集合   结构中的数据元素除了同属于一种类型外,别无其它关系。  线性结构    结构中的数据元素之间存在一对一的关系。  树型结构       结构中的数据元素之间存在一对多的关系。  图状结构或网状结构   结构中的数据元素之间存在多对多的关系。   数据结构在计算机中有两种不同的存储方法: 顺序存储结构:用数据元素在存储...
分类:编程语言   时间:2014-12-24 10:06:53    阅读次数:180
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!